WebGiving birth. Once your cat’s starts to give birth, strong contractions and straining will begin. The first kitten is normally born within 30 minutes of straining starting, and following kittens should come every 10-60 minutes. Kittens are normally born inside a thin sac, which your cat should tear off, enabling them to breath.
